Announcing Roboflow's $40M Series B Funding
Products
Platform
Universe
Open source computer vision datasets and pre-trained models
Annotate
Label images fast with AI-assisted data annotation
Train
Hosted model training infrastructure and GPU access
Workflows
Low-code interface to build pipelines and applications
Deploy
Run models on device, at the edge, in your VPC, or via API
Solutions
By Industry
Aerospace & Defence
Agriculture
Automotive
Banking & Finance
Government
Healthcare & Medicine
Manufacturing
Oil & Gas
Retail & Ecommerce
Safety & Security
Telecommunications
Transportation
Utilities
Developers
Resources
Documentation
User Forum
Computer Vision Models
Blog
Convert Annotation Formats
Learn Computer Vision
Inference Templates
Weekly Product Webinar
Pricing
Docs
Blog
Sign In
Get Started
Workflows
Blocks
Building Blocks for Custom Vision Pipelines
Connect models from OpenAI or Meta AI, applications like Slack or Pager Duty, and logic like filtering or cropping.
Filter Models
Search Blocks
Filter By Category
All
Utility
Notifications
Tracker
Flow Control
Sink
Fusion
Transformation
Model
Filter By Type
All
Basic
Premium
Enterprise
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Apply
Showing
of
blocks.
Image Contours
Find and count the contours on an image.
Enterprise
Premium
Apache-2.0
Image Threshold
Apply a threshold to an image.
Enterprise
Premium
Apache-2.0
Image Convert Grayscale
Convert an RGB image to grayscale.
Enterprise
Premium
Apache-2.0
Image Blur
Apply a blur to an image.
Enterprise
Premium
Apache-2.0
Template Matching
Looks for instances of template in specific image
Enterprise
Premium
Apache-2.0
SIFT
Apply SIFT to an image.
Enterprise
Premium
Apache-2.0
SIFT Comparison
Compare SIFT descriptors from multiple images.
Enterprise
Premium
Apache-2.0
Pixel Color Count
Count the number of pixels that match a specific color within a given tolerance.
Enterprise
Premium
Apache-2.0
Dominant Color
Get the dominant color of an image in RGB format.
Enterprise
Premium
Apache-2.0
Detections Stitch
Merges detections made against multiple pieces of input image into single detection.
Enterprise
Premium
Apache-2.0
Roboflow Custom Metadata
Add custom metadata to Roboflow Model Monitoring dashboard
Enterprise
Premium
Apache-2.0
Triangle Visualization
Draws triangle markers on an image at specific coordinates based on provided detections.
Enterprise
Premium
Apache-2.0
Polygon Visualization
Draws a polygon around detected objects in an image.
Enterprise
Premium
Apache-2.0
Pixelate Visualization
Pixelates detected objects in an image.
Enterprise
Premium
Apache-2.0
Mask Visualization
Paints a mask over detected objects in an image.
Enterprise
Premium
Apache-2.0
Label Visualization
Draws labels on an image at specific coordinates based on provided detections.
Enterprise
Premium
Apache-2.0
Halo Visualization
Paints a halo around detected objects in an image.
Enterprise
Premium
Apache-2.0
Ellipse Visualization
Draws ellipses that highlight detected objects in an image.
Enterprise
Premium
Apache-2.0
Dot Visualization
Draws dots on an image at specific coordinates based on provided detections.
Enterprise
Premium
Apache-2.0
Crop Visualization
Draws scaled up crops of detections on the scene.
Enterprise
Premium
Apache-2.0
Corner Visualization
Draws the corners of detected objects in an image.
Enterprise
Premium
Apache-2.0
Color Visualization
Paints a solid color on detected objects in an image.
Enterprise
Premium
Apache-2.0
Circle Visualization
Draws a circle around detected objects in an image.
Enterprise
Premium
Apache-2.0
Bounding Box Visualization
Draws a box around detected objects in an image.
Enterprise
Premium
Apache-2.0
Blur Visualization
Blurs detected objects in an image.
Enterprise
Premium
Apache-2.0
Background Color Visualization
Paints a mask over all areas outside of detected regions in an image.
Enterprise
Premium
Apache-2.0
First Non Empty Or Default
Takes first non-empty data element or default
Enterprise
Premium
Apache-2.0
Dimension Collapse
Collapses dimensionality level by aggregation of nested data into list
Enterprise
Premium
Apache-2.0
Property Definition
Define a variable from model predictions, such as the class names, confidences, or number of detections.
Enterprise
Premium
Apache-2.0
Detections Classes Replacement
Replaces classes of detections with classes predicted by a chained classification model
Enterprise
Premium
Apache-2.0
Dynamic Zone
Simplify polygons so they are geometrically convex and simplify them to contain only requested amount of vertices
Enterprise
Premium
Apache-2.0
Perspective Correction
Correct coordinates of detections from plane defined by given polygon to straight rectangular plane of given width and height
Enterprise
Premium
Apache-2.0
Roboflow Dataset Upload
Save images and predictions in your Roboflow Dataset
Enterprise
Premium
Apache-2.0
Detections Transformation
Apply transformations on detected bounding boxes.
Enterprise
Premium
Apache-2.0
Detections Filter
Conditionally filter out model predictions.
Enterprise
Premium
Apache-2.0
Dynamic Crop
Crop an image using bounding boxes from a detection model.
Enterprise
Premium
Apache-2.0
QR Code Detection
Detect and read QR codes in an image.
Enterprise
Premium
Apache-2.0
Barcode Detection
Detect and read barcodes in an image.
Enterprise
Premium
Apache-2.0
Object Detection Model
Predict the location of objects with bounding boxes.
Enterprise
Premium
Apache-2.0
Multi-Label Classification Model
Apply multiple tags to an image.
Enterprise
Premium
Apache-2.0
Single-Label Classification Model
Apply a single tag to an image.
Enterprise
Premium
Apache-2.0
Keypoint Detection Model
Predict skeletons on objects.
Enterprise
Premium
Apache-2.0
Instance Segmentation Model
Predict the shape, size, and location of objects.
Enterprise
Premium
Apache-2.0
YOLO-World Model
Run a zero-shot object detection model.
Enterprise
Premium
Apache-2.0
OpenAI
Run OpenAI's GPT-4 with Vision
Enterprise
Premium
Apache-2.0
Segment Anything 2 Model
Convert bounding boxes to polygons, or run SAM2 on an entire image to generate a mask.
Enterprise
Premium
Apache-2.0
Continue If
Continue a branch of logic if a condition is met.
Enterprise
Premium
Expression
Evaluate a condition and return a response.
Enterprise
Premium
Segment Anything 2
Use SAM 2 to segment objects in an image.
Enterprise
Premium
Image Slicer
Use SAHI to run sliced inference with a computer vision model.
Enterprise
Premium
DetectionsConsensus
Combine predictions from multiple detections models to make a decision about object presence.
Enterprise
Premium
Apache-2.0
Serializer
Convert object detection predictions into serialized format, facilitating data transfer or storage within workflow pipelines.
Sink
Enterprise
Premium
Enterprise
Azure Sink
This block sends email alerts with images and predictions.
Notifications
Enterprise
Premium
Premium
S3 Upload
Send images and prediction files to AWS S3.
Utility
Enterprise
Premium
Premium
SMS
Send SMS notifications through Twilio based on configurable conditions, utilizing dynamic message content and sender/receiver details.
Notifications
Enterprise
Premium
Premium
MQTT Publisher
Publish serialized data payloads to an MQTT broker, handling connection management and error reporting.
Sink
Enterprise
Premium
Enterprise
Webhook Publish
Securely transmit data to specified webhooks using HMAC-SHA512 for payload authentication, ensuring data integrity and confidentiality.
Sink
Enterprise
Premium
Premium
Super Annotator
Enhance images with visual annotations based on detection predictions, combining bounding boxes and labels for clarity.
Sink
Enterprise
Premium
Basic
Non Empty Predictions Tagger
Tag batches of images with boolean flags indicating the presence or absence of predictions for various detection types.
Transformation
Enterprise
Premium
Basic
Prediction Alarm
Monitor and trigger an alarm if the count of specified prediction classes within a defined timeframe exceeds a set threshold.
Transformation
Enterprise
Premium
Enterprise
Filter
Conditionally filter and output data fields based on boolean conditions from a preceding workflow step.
Transformation
Enterprise
Premium
Basic
Slack
Send notifications to a specified Slack channel based on conditions, using customizable message content and Slack API tokens.
Notifications
Enterprise
Premium
Premium
CSV Sink
Export prediction data to a CSV file for various prediction kinds, including object detection and instance segmentation.
Sink
Enterprise
Premium
Premium
Kafka Publish
Publish data to a Kafka topic, with server connection and topic configuration, ensuring data propagation within distributed systems.
Transformation
Enterprise
Premium
Enterprise
Pager Duty
Trigger alerts on PagerDuty based on configurable conditions, sending notifications with customized details about system events.
Notifications
Enterprise
Premium
Enterprise
AWS Secrets Retriever
Retrieve and manage secrets from AWS Secrets Manager for use in workflow automation.
Transformation
Enterprise
Premium
Enterprise
Random Sampler
Randomly sample images based on a specified percentage, triggering actions for selected images within workflow processes.
Transformation
Enterprise
Premium
Basic
Byte Tracker
Track and update object positions across video frames using ByteTrack.
Tracker
Enterprise
Premium
Premium
GPT-4 with Vision
GPT-4 with Vision is a type of LMM.
Model
Enterprise
Premium
Basic
CogVLM
CogVLM is a type of LMM.
Model
Enterprise
Premium
Basic
YOLOv8 Classification
YOLOv8 Classification is a type of Roboflow Classification Model.
Model
Enterprise
Premium
Basic
YOLOv8 Keypoint Detection
YOLOv8 Keypoint Detection is a type of Roboflow Keypoint Detection Model.
Model
Enterprise
Premium
Basic
YOLOv7 Instance Segmentation
YOLOv7 Instance Segmentation is a type of Roboflow Instance Segmentation Model.
Model
Enterprise
Premium
Basic
YOLOv8 Instance Segmentation
YOLOv8 Instance Segmentation is a type of Roboflow Instance Segmentation Model.
Model
Enterprise
Premium
Basic
YOLOv5 Instance Segmentation
YOLOv5 Instance Segmentation is a type of Roboflow Instance Segmentation Model.
Model
Enterprise
Premium
Basic
YOLOv5
YOLOv5 is a type of Roboflow Object Detection Model.
Model
Enterprise
Premium
Basic
YOLO-NAS
YOLO-NAS is a type of Roboflow Object Detection Model.
Model
Enterprise
Premium
Basic
YOLOv9
YOLOv9 is a type of Roboflow Object Detection Model.
Model
Enterprise
Premium
Basic
YOLOv8
YOLOv8 is a type of Roboflow Object Detection Model.
Model
Enterprise
Premium
Basic
Relative Static Crop
Use relative coordinates for cropping.
Transformation
Enterprise
Premium
Basic
Detection Offset
Apply a fixed offset on the width and height of detections.
Transformation
Enterprise
Premium
Basic
Detection Filter
Filter predictions from detection models based on defined conditions.
Transformation
Enterprise
Premium
Basic
Crop
Create dynamic crops from a detections model.
Transformation
Enterprise
Premium
Basic
Absolute Static Crop
Use absolute coordinates for cropping.
Transformation
Enterprise
Premium
Basic
Active Learning Data Collector
Collect data and predictions that flow through workflows for use in active learning.
Sink
Enterprise
Premium
Basic
QR Code Detector
Detect the location of QR codes in an image.
Model
Enterprise
Premium
Basic
Barcode Detector
Run Optical Character Recognition on a model.
Model
Enterprise
Premium
Basic
Roboflow Object Detection Model
Detect objects using an object detection model.
Model
Enterprise
Premium
Basic
Roboflow Multi Label Classification Model
Run a multi-label classification model.
Model
Enterprise
Premium
Basic
Roboflow Classification Model
Run a classification model.
Model
Enterprise
Premium
Basic
Roboflow Keypoint Detection Model
Run inference on a keypoint detection model.
Model
Enterprise
Premium
Basic
Roboflow Instance Segmentation Model
Run an instance segmentation model.
Model
Enterprise
Premium
Basic
Yolo World Model
Run a zero-shot object detection model.
Model
Enterprise
Premium
Basic
OCR Model
Run Optical Character Recognition on a model.
Model
Enterprise
Premium
Basic
LMM For Classification
Run a large language model for classification.
Model
Enterprise
Premium
Basic
LMM
Run a large language model.
Model
Enterprise
Premium
Basic
Clip Comparison
Compare CLIP image and text embeddings.
Model
Enterprise
Premium
Basic
Detections Consensus
Combine predictions from multiple detections models to make a decision about object presence.
Fusion
Enterprise
Premium
Basic
Condition
Control the flow of a workflow based on the result of a step.
Flow Control
Enterprise
Premium
Basic
Oops!
It seems there are no results matching your filters.